"I'm not to sure if this go poster or not the first time, I have a 1995 Ocean Pro 150, I think that the starter is shot, It started right up for me the other day but after I shut it down and tried again the starter had a heck of a time turning the motor over, it acted like the battery was low, so I took the battery out and charged it up, I cleand all the wires off also, I then stuck it back in and again the started had a heck of a time tring to turn the motor over, the starter was warm-hot but the cables were not to bad. I plan on cleaning all the cable up again and then trying it again, but something is telling me it's the starter, the motor has very little hours on it but it has been sitting for a while, what do you guys think, it sucks because their is a fishing tournament this weekend, it's always something. Take it apart and check that the brushes are not sticking and clean the anchor collector with some 1200wet grinding paper with some WD40. Clean off the collector again before assembly.
